1. Baking Soda as well as Vinegar


Instead of making use of any form of chemicals or bleach, this method is more secure and also not unsafe to you or your sink. Sodium bicarbonate and also vinegar are day-to-day home items used for many other points, and they can do the trick to your kitchen sink.
Firstly, remove any kind of water that is left in the sink with a cup.
Then pour a great quantity of cooking soft drink away.
Pour in one mug of vinegar.
Seal the drain opening as well as allow it to settle for some minutes.
Pour warm water away to dissolve various other persistent residue as well as bits.
Following this easy approach can work, as well as you can have your kitchen sink back. Repeat the process as much as you consider essential to clear the sink of this debris completely.

2. Attempt a Plunger


You can try using a plunger if the trouble is not from the garbage disposal. Bettors are typical house devices for this occasion, and they can be available in useful if you utilize them correctly. A flat-bottomed plunger is most appropriate for this, but you can use what you have is a toilet bettor.
Follow the following simple actions to use the bettor successfully:
Secure the drain with a dustcloth as well as fill the sink with some warm water
Place the plunger ready over the drain and also begin diving
Check to see if the water runs freely after a couple of plunges
Repeat the process until the drain is free

HOW TO UNCLOG A SINK DRAIN: 5 HELPFUL TIPS FROM PLUMBING EXPERTS


Using soap and hot water


If the clog is caused by grease accumulations, pouring dish soap down the drain, followed by a large pot of boiling water, may dissolve the clog. Use about to 1 cup of soap and about a gallon of water, being careful not to burn yourself.


Using a solution of baking soda, vinegar, and hot water


For more stubborn clogs, a combination of baking soda, vinegar, and hot water may do the trick. Because vinegar is an acid and baking soda is a base, mixing the two will cause a chemical reaction that will create pressure and possibly dislodge the clog. For this method, pour cup of baking soda down the drain, followed by cup of white vinegar and, then, plenty of hot water.



If none of these methods work, it may be time to call a plumbing expert for help. Experienced plumbers can provide professional drain cleaning services, removing any stubborn clogs without damaging your plumbing system. They can also determine if your drain problems are being caused by something more problematic, like damaged pipes or sewer line clogs.


Plunging


A standard plunger can unclog many sink drains with minimal effort. When plunging sinks, make sure that any overflow openings in the sink are covered with wet rags. Then, cover the sink drain with the plunger, and plunge 5 to 10 times to try to break up the clog. If you have a double sink, make sure that the second drain is covered. And, if your first attempt at plunging fails, run some hot water down the drain, then try again.


Snaking


If you have a pipe snake, a coat hanger, or a stiff wire, you can try to physically dislodge the clog by feeding the wire down the drain. When using this method, do not force the wire too hard. Also, make sure that you can easily pull it back up whenever necessary.
